Replays and reruns.

I mean, sure, it’s a completely obvious idea that was just waiting for someone to actually take the time to do it, but I prefer to think that I’m prescient and totally on the edge of future trends.

Your reward for playing a game? Another game!

Games as unlockable content in other games.